Output 09d28161ce06ee0db702685121629f145fd1fe8dfe72bc84c59d2d2dc4e5ecfe:9

value
2972799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b08facacb91eddd0fb1d9df1993e6f872e1d56d OP_EQUAL
address
3CuZo4Dy6J8PukZnZKBKkyP9s3kobHmJRp
transaction
09d28161ce06ee0db702685121629f145fd1fe8dfe72bc84c59d2d2dc4e5ecfe
confirmations
22344
spent
true